变量:VAR_STAT
此功能是 IEC 61131-3 标准的扩展。
您可以在关键字之间局部声明静态变量 VAR_STAT
和 END_VAR
。静态变量在下载时初始化。
您只能从声明变量的命名空间内访问静态变量(如 C 中的静态变量)。但是当应用程序离开块时,静态变量会保留它们的值。例如,您可以使用静态变量作为函数调用的计数器。
该变量可以使用属性关键字进行扩展(CONSTANT
, RETAIN
, 或者 PERSISTENT
)。
例 87. 例子
VAR_STAT iVarStat1 : INT; END_VAR